Output 95a630f3be68ec2553c99a69d7f0c0a6e3bcd3d7f586b60f066e20792526212a:0

value
1000120
script pubkey
OP_0 OP_PUSHBYTES_20 ef91cb8620d809f5023dffdbc176fcc488e17371
address
bc1qa7guhp3qmqyl2q3allduzahucjywzum32e093n
transaction
95a630f3be68ec2553c99a69d7f0c0a6e3bcd3d7f586b60f066e20792526212a
spent
true